England will take on the West Indies in the first of the three-match ODI series. This article provides details about England's Playing 11 vs West Indies for the first of the three-match ODI series.
England Playing 11 vs West Indies- 1st ODI, West Indies tour of England 2025:
Openers: Jos Buttler, Ben Duckett
Former English white ball captain Jos Buttler will open the innings for the home side in the first ODI against West Indies and will be partnered by Ben Duckett.
The pair will look to shrug off the disappointing performance that the team delivered in the 2023 ODI World Cup held in India and in the Champions Trophy.
Buttler and Duckett are known for their aggressive batting approach at the top of the order and will look to replicate the same in the upcoming game.
Duckett will look to put on a solid show with the bat and carry on the rich vein of form he has been in.
Buttler, on the other hand, is now one of the senior members of the team and would want to take the confidence of his IPL performance in the first ODI at Edgbaston.
Middle-order batsmen and all-rounders: Jamie Smith (wk), Joe Root, Harry Brook (c), Jacob Bethell
The opening combination will be followed by a relatively inexperienced batting which comprises Jamie Smith, the newly appointed skipper, Harry Brook, and spin bowling all-rounder Jacob Bethell.
The composition of the middle order makes Joe Root a very important part of the current English ODI setup, which hasn't been able to make a significant contribution in the last year or so.
Having said that, the first ODI against the West Indies is a chance for these less-experienced batters to get some runs under their belt.
England will surely miss someone like Ben Stokes, who played an important part in guiding the team to their first ODI World Cup title.
Bowlers: Jamie Overton, Brydon Carse, Mathew Potts, Adil Rashid, Saqib Mahmood
England will field a fairly new-look bowling attack with the likes of Jofra Archer and Chris Woakes not a part of the ODI series against the West Indies.
The duo of Saqib Mahmood and Mathew Potts is expected to take the new ball. Both bowlers will have an opportunity to put on a solid display of fast bowling against the West Indies openers.
Mahmood and Potts will hope to get good support from fellow fast bowlers Brydon Carse and Jamie Overton, both of whom have impressed the experts with the way they have bowled so far.
The fast bowling department will have to take responsibility for themselves in the absence of a genuine all-rounder like Stokes, who can be relied upon to bowl a few overs when the need arises.
As far as England's spin bowling is concerned, all eyes will be on Adil Rashid, who will be supported by Jacob Bethell. Adil Rashid, the leg spinner, is the most experienced spinner in the English bowling lineup.
